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2021-33621 Explained : Impact and Mitigation

Discover the impact of CVE-2021-33621, where the Ruby cgi gem allows HTTP response splitting, enabling attackers to manipulate user input. Learn to mitigate and prevent risks.

A detailed overview of CVE-2021-33621, covering its description, impact, technical details, mitigation, and prevention mechanisms.

Understanding CVE-2021-33621

This section provides insights into the CVE-2021-33621 vulnerability and its implications.

What is CVE-2021-33621?

The cgi gem before 0.1.0.2, 0.2.x before 0.2.2, and 0.3.x before 0.3.5 for Ruby allows HTTP response splitting. Relevant to applications using untrusted user input to generate an HTTP response or create a CGI::Cookie object.

The Impact of CVE-2021-33621

The vulnerability enables HTTP response splitting, impacting the integrity of applications that process untrusted user input.

Technical Details of CVE-2021-33621

Explore the specific technical aspects related to CVE-2021-33621.

Vulnerability Description

The vulnerability in the Ruby cgi gem versions creates a scenario for HTTP response splitting, affecting CGI::Cookie object generation.

Affected Systems and Versions

All versions of the cgi gem before 0.1.0.2, 0.2.x before 0.2.2, and 0.3.x before 0.3.5 for Ruby are vulnerable to HTTP response splitting.

Exploitation Mechanism

An attacker can exploit this vulnerability by manipulating untrusted user input to inject malicious data into HTTP responses or CGI::Cookie objects.

Mitigation and Prevention

Learn about the steps to mitigate and prevent the CVE-2021-33621 vulnerability.

Immediate Steps to Take

Developers should update the Ruby cgi gem to the patched versions (0.1.0.2, 0.2.2, 0.3.5) to prevent HTTP response splitting attacks.

Long-Term Security Practices

Implement robust input validation mechanisms and avoid accepting untrusted user input without proper sanitization in applications.

Patching and Updates

Regularly monitor for security advisories and apply updates promptly to stay protected against known vulnerabilities.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now